Key Ingredients for Savory Breakfast Muffins

Almond Flour
For these savory breakfast muffins, almond flour serves as the base, providing a delightful nuttiness and a gluten-free option that’s rich in protein. It adds a lovely texture while keeping the muffins moist and satisfying.

Raw Hemp Seed
I love incorporating raw hemp seeds for their crunch and nutritional benefits. These little powerhouses are packed with omega-3 fatty acids and protein, making your breakfast a veritable superfood experience that fuels your day ahead.

Parmesan Cheese
Adding freshly grated Parmesan cheese elevates the flavor profile of these muffins. Its savory, umami richness perfectly complements the other ingredients, ensuring each bite bursts with cheesy goodness.

Flax Seed Meal
Flax seed meal plays a crucial role as a binding agent. It also provides a boost of fiber and omega-3s, making these muffins not only delicious but also nutritious.

Nutritional Yeast Flakes
For a cheesy flavor without the dairy, I use nutritional yeast flakes. They add a unique, savory taste while contributing additional B vitamins to keep your energy levels high.

Eggs
Eggs are essential in this recipe, lending structure and richness to the muffins. They also help to keep the texture light and fluffy, making every bite enjoyable.

Cottage Cheese
Incorporating cottage cheese adds moisture and protein, ensuring that these savory breakfast muffins are not only tasty but also filling enough to keep you satisfied.

Green Onions
Finally, don’t forget the green onions! They bring a fresh, zesty note to the muffins, enhancing both the flavor and visual appeal. A sprinkle of these brilliant greens makes the muffins pop!

Cooking Tips and Notes

Perfecting Texture

When crafting savory breakfast muffins, achieving the right texture is crucial. To enhance this, I recommend using a combination of finely grated vegetables, like zucchini or carrot, which not only add moisture but also infuse wonderful flavors. Make sure to squeeze out excess moisture from these veggies; your muffins will be perfectly fluffy and not overly dense!

Baking Time Adjustments

Oven temperatures can vary, so keep a close eye on your muffins as they bake. The recommended baking time is typically around 20–25 minutes, but I’d suggest checking for doneness a few minutes earlier. A toothpick inserted into the center should come out clean. If your muffins still seem wet, slide them back in for a couple more minutes, but be careful not to dry them out.

Ingredient Substitutions

Don’t hesitate to get creative with your savory breakfast muffins! If you’re out of egg, a flaxseed meal mixed with water works wonderfully as a binder. For those who prefer dairy-free, almond or coconut milk can be great alternatives to traditional dairy. Also, consider spicing things up: a dash of smoked paprika or fresh herbs like cilantro can elevate your muffins even further.

FAQs about Savory Breakfast Muffins

When you make savory breakfast muffins, you’ll discover that they not only offer a delicious start to your day but also raise a few questions. Here are some common queries we’ve encountered, along with helpful answers.

Can I freeze these muffins?

Absolutely! Freezing savory breakfast muffins is a fantastic way to ensure you always have a nutritious breakfast option on hand. Once they’ve cooled completely, wrap each muffin tightly in plastic wrap or aluminum foil, then transfer them to an airtight container or freezer bag. Label with the date, and they should retain their quality for up to three months. When you’re ready to enjoy one, simply remove it from the freezer and reheat in the microwave or oven—perfect for those busy mornings!

What can I use instead of nutritional yeast?

If you find yourself without nutritional yeast while making savory breakfast muffins, don’t worry! You can substitute it with grated Parmesan cheese for a cheesy flavor, or for a dairy-free option, try ground flaxseed or chia seeds combined with a splash more of your favorite plant-based milk. Each of these alternatives imparts a unique flavor profile while still keeping your muffins delicious.

How do I store leftovers?

To maintain the freshness of your savory breakfast muffins, store them in an airtight container at room temperature for up to three days. If you want to keep them longer, consider refrigerating them for up to a week. Just reheat in the microwave for a few seconds when you’re ready to enjoy them again. Ingredients

Scale
  • 1/2 cup almond flour
  • 1/2 cup raw hemp seed
  • 1/2 cup finely-gr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1/4 cup flax seed meal
  • 1/4 cup nutritional yeast flakes
  • 1/2 tsp. ba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p. Spike Seasoning (optional but good; can substitute any all-purpose seasoning mix)
  • 1/4 tsp. salt
  • 6 eggs, beaten
  • 1/2 cup cottage cheese
  • 1/3 cup thinly sliced green onion

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 375F/190C.
  2. Spray baking cups or muffin pan with non-stick spray or olive oil.
  3. In a medium-sized bowl, mix together the almond flour, raw hemp seed, Parmesan cheese, flax seed meal, nutritional yeast flakes, baking powder, Spike Seasoning (if using), and salt.
  4. In a smaller bowl, beat the eggs and then mix in the cottage cheese and thinly sliced green onions.
  5. Mix the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ients.
  6. Scoop out the mixture with a small measuring cup and fill the muffin cups until they are nearly full, dividing the mixture evenly between the muffin cups.
  7. Bake for 25-30 minutes, or until the muffins are firm and nicely browned.
  8. The muffins will keep in the fridge for at least a week and can be reheated in the microwave or in a toaster oven.

Notes

  • If using larger muffin cups, you may get fewer muffins and may need to cook them slightly longer.
